
The Patrick Madrid Show: June 08, 2026 - Hour 3
About this episode
Patrick tackles the heated debate over renaming the Department of Defense to the Department of War, weighing whether this signals realignment or empty bravado, while threading through the risks faced by religious minorities as government classifications shift and anti-Catholic voices grow bolder among power brokers. One moment snaps into focus on the rise of Christian nationalism and the uneasy possibility of theocracy-influenced policy; the next, Patrick pivots to the digital anxieties fracturing generations as technology encroaches on how people gather and worship. Listeners drop raw testimony about confession and faith, lending the episode its unpredictable charge.
